Here are the features of the GF1:
Features
- 12.1 Megapixel 4/3-type Live MOS sensor
- Full-time Live View (3.0-inch, 460,000-dot LCD)
- Venus Engine HD image processor
- Supersonic Dust Reduction System
- 23-area Contrast auto focus
- High-speed consecutive burst shooting
- Intelligent auto (iA) mode
- MEGA O.I.S. (Optical image stabilizer)*
- Auto focus tracking
- Intelligent ISO control with motion detection
- Face detection AF/AE
- Face recognition
- Intelligent scene selector
- Intelligent exposure
- Digital red-eye correction
- Automatic backlight compensation
